Discussions:
1.) Snow King Repeater (146.910/146.310)
 
* The County approved, ordered and received the new Kenwood Repeater, Amplifier & Power Supply.  David had it on display at the meeting, with all components mounted in the metal housing enclosure/brackets, ready for installation on Snow King.
 
* It will be installed ASAP, depending on weather & road condition of back road to Snow King summit.
 
* The P/L tone will be 123 HZ.
 
2.) There will be a Statewide ARES/RACES drill or exercise on June 11th.  More info later.
 
3.) The purchase of Pocket Pagers is being considered to be used for immediate alert in the event of an emergency and the ARES/RACES group is activated by the county.
 
4.) The Club is considering attaining a N0N-PROFIT status in order to become a recipient of Community Foundation Funds.
 
5.) Field Day: CORRECTION - FD will be June 25th & 26th, not the 26th & 27th as mentioned by me in the meeting.
* The Club will again enter as Class F (E.O.C.) in the Comm Trailer and the adjoining ICT Trailer.
* Band Pass Filters will be used to minimize cross band interference.
 
6.) W7RAC QSL Cards will be ordered for Field Day and DX contact confirmations.
 
7.) Jim, WA7IFX, advised that the Bulletin Board at the Visitor's Center is available for posting TRAC schedules, events, meetings, etc.
 
8.) For those interested, Red Cross will provide CPR & other First Aid courses.
 
9.) Club Dues:  The Club now has $120.00 in a Checking Account at the Bank of Jackson Hole.
